WDC vs. STX: Which HDD Giant Is More Dependent on Cloud Customers? A Comparison of Customers, Products, and Cash Flow

WDC vs STX cloud customer exposure and data center HDD demand

If you want to know whether WDC or STX is more dependent on cloud customers, the direct answer is this: based on reported revenue categories, WDC has the clearer and higher cloud exposure. After the Sandisk separation, Western Digital is now much more focused on HDD and data center storage. Seagate is also deeply tied to hyperscalers, but its cloud exposure is reflected more through mass capacity storage, nearline HDD, HAMR, and high-capacity drive cycles rather than a simple “cloud revenue percentage.” In other words, WDC is more visibly cloud-dependent, while STX is highly cloud-sensitive through product demand and technology transitions.

Start With Disclosure: WDC’s Cloud Exposure Is Easier to Measure

Cloud data centers and HDD storage infrastructure

If you only use reported business segments, WDC looks more dependent on cloud customers. Western Digital reports Cloud, Client, and Consumer revenue, so you can directly see how much of the business is tied to cloud and data center demand. Seagate does not present revenue in the same Cloud / Client / Consumer structure. Its cloud dependence is embedded in mass capacity storage, nearline HDD, high-capacity drives, hyperscale customers, and HAMR product transitions.

The most important starting point is that Western Digital should no longer be analyzed with the old “HDD plus NAND flash” framework. In WDC Q3 FY2026 results, the company presented its results after the Sandisk separation, meaning the continuing business is now much more concentrated around hard drives and data storage infrastructure. For you, that changes the comparison with Seagate. The key variables are now HDD revenue, nearline exabytes, cloud customer demand, gross margin, and free cash flow.

WDC’s cloud revenue visibility is unusually high. In its Q3 FY2026 Financial Results, Western Digital reported that Cloud represented about 89% of revenue, while Client was about 5% and Consumer was about 6%. That is not a mild business tilt. It is a data center-led structure. From Q3 FY2025 to Q3 FY2026, Cloud stayed in the high-80% range, which tells you that WDC’s revenue is now highly sensitive to cloud customers, enterprise data centers, and high-capacity HDD procurement.

Seagate’s structure is different. In Seagate’s 2025 Form 10-K, the company emphasized that cloud and hyperscale data centers are increasing storage capacity for both AI-specific workloads and traditional cloud infrastructure. But Seagate does not break down revenue in a way that lets you simply say, “Cloud is X% of sales.” Instead, you need to infer cloud exposure from mass capacity revenue, nearline demand, high-capacity drive adoption, and management commentary on hyperscale customers.

Comparison Point WDC STX What It Means
Reporting structure Cloud / Client / Consumer Mass capacity / legacy / other WDC is easier to quantify
Cloud revenue visibility Very high Medium WDC is more transparent
Core product driver Nearline HDD, ePMR Nearline HDD, HAMR, Mozaic STX has a stronger technology-cycle narrative
Dependency signal High cloud revenue share Cloud demand embedded in product mix Both depend on cloud, but in different ways

The distinction matters because investors often confuse “not directly disclosed” with “not important.” STX may not show a clean cloud revenue percentage, but that does not mean cloud customers are less important to Seagate’s cycle. A large part of Seagate’s growth story depends on whether hyperscalers continue buying high-capacity HDDs for data lakes, object storage, backup, AI data retention, and cold storage.

Bottom line: If you ask, “Which company looks more dependent on cloud customers in reported financials?” the answer is WDC. Its Cloud share is explicit and very high. If you ask, “Which company is more exposed to real cloud storage demand?” the answer becomes more balanced. STX is also deeply tied to cloud customers, but the exposure appears through nearline HDD, mass capacity storage, HAMR qualification, and hyperscaler procurement cycles. WDC is the clearer cloud-revenue story; STX is the more technology-cycle-driven cloud storage story.

Customer Concentration: WDC’s Large-Customer Risk Is More Visible

Customer concentration and long-term data center procurement

Customer concentration gives a more direct answer than product language alone. WDC has more visible large-customer exposure. In FY2025, Western Digital’s top ten customers generated 68% of net revenue, with three customers contributing 17%, 12%, and 10%, respectively. Seagate also has large-customer exposure, but its FY2025 disclosure showed one customer at about 10% of consolidated revenue. That makes WDC’s customer concentration risk more explicit.

Customer concentration is easy to underestimate in the HDD industry. Many investors look at AI data centers, stock price moves, and gross margin expansion, but they forget that the end-buyer structure has changed. High-capacity nearline HDD is no longer driven mainly by PC demand or fragmented retail channels. It is increasingly tied to hyperscalers, cloud infrastructure operators, large enterprise customers, and object storage platforms.

According to the WDC 2025 Annual Report, the company’s top ten customers represented 68% of FY2025 net revenue, up from 55% in FY2024 and 56% in FY2023. Three customers accounted for 17%, 12%, and 10% of net revenue. Those numbers show that WDC’s growth is heavily linked to large buyers, not a broad base of small customers.

That concentration can be positive. Large cloud customers usually have long planning cycles, strict qualification standards, and large-scale storage needs. Once a supplier is qualified, the relationship can bring better demand visibility than consumer channels. But the same concentration can also increase volatility. If a top cloud customer delays procurement, changes inventory policy, pushes harder on pricing, or shifts capacity to another supplier, the impact on WDC can be direct.

Seagate’s large-customer risk is less visible in the same way. In Seagate’s FY2025 filing, one customer accounted for around 10% of consolidated revenue. That does not mean STX is less exposed to hyperscalers. It means the risk is less obvious through a single customer concentration line. For Seagate, the bigger question is whether the broader cloud customer base continues buying mass capacity HDDs and whether new high-capacity products pass qualification smoothly.

Metric WDC STX Investment Meaning
Top ten customer share 68% in FY2025 Not directly comparable by the same metric WDC’s concentration is more visible
Large individual customers 17%, 12%, 10% Around 10% for one customer WDC needs closer customer monitoring
Cloud impact Seen in revenue category and customer concentration Seen in mass capacity demand STX requires product-cycle analysis
Main risk Large-customer order changes Industry demand and product transition risk Risk sources are different

Customer concentration is not automatically good or bad. You should read it as a source of both scale and risk.

  • High concentration can improve demand visibility and deepen supply relationships.
  • High concentration can increase pricing pressure and order-cycle volatility.
  • Lower visible concentration may reduce single-customer shock.
  • Lower visible concentration does not remove industry-wide hyperscaler risk.

Bottom line: WDC’s cloud customer dependence is more visible because it appears in both revenue mix and customer concentration. The company’s top ten customers generated 68% of FY2025 revenue, and three customers each represented at least 10%. STX does not show the same level of visible customer concentration, but it is still highly tied to cloud spending through mass capacity HDD demand. For WDC, track large-customer behavior closely. For STX, track the broader cloud procurement cycle, high-capacity drive demand, and HAMR adoption.

Product Structure: WDC Has Higher Cloud Storage Purity, STX Has Stronger Technology-Cycle Leverage

Nearline HDD and high-capacity storage product cycles

Product structure gives a more nuanced answer. WDC looks like the purer cloud storage revenue play, while STX looks more like a technology-cycle leverage play. WDC’s key indicators are Cloud revenue, nearline exabytes, ePMR, high-capacity HDD shipments, and gross margin. STX’s key indicators are mass capacity revenue, HAMR, Mozaic, areal density, customer qualification, and cost per terabyte. WDC is easier to read through revenue mix; STX is easier to read through product transition.

WDC’s product focus is nearline HDD. In Q3 FY2026, Western Digital reported total exabytes of 222, including 199 nearline exabytes and 23 non-nearline exabytes. That means the shipped-capacity base is overwhelmingly driven by nearline products. Nearline HDD is commonly used for cloud data centers, object storage, backup, archives, data lakes, cold data, and large-scale persistent storage.

That is why WDC’s AI data center narrative is credible. AI infrastructure is not only about GPU, HBM, CoWoS, and advanced semiconductors. AI systems also create and consume massive amounts of data. Training datasets, inference logs, generated media, model checkpoints, compliance records, backups, and enterprise document stores all need persistent storage. Some of that data requires SSD performance, but a large share needs low-cost, high-capacity HDD storage.

Seagate’s product narrative is more tied to mass capacity and HAMR. In Seagate FY2025 results, management pointed to strong cloud customer demand for high-capacity drives and continued progress on HAMR product qualification. Seagate’s story is not just “cloud revenue is rising.” It is about increasing areal density, improving drive capacity, lowering cost per terabyte, and helping customers store more data with better power and space efficiency.

Seagate has also connected its product roadmap directly to AI storage demand. The company’s 30TB Exos HDD messaging highlights the relationship between AI workloads, data center demand, and high-capacity HDD. At the Seagate 2025 Investor and Analyst Event, the company focused on areal density leadership and long-term value creation in a data-driven world. That is the core STX thesis: higher density, larger drives, and better cost efficiency can support cloud storage growth.

Product Variable WDC Focus STX Focus How to Read It
Cloud revenue Directly disclosed Not disclosed in the same structure WDC is more transparent
Capacity shipped Nearline exabytes Mass capacity HDD Both depend on data centers
Technology path ePMR, high-capacity nearline HAMR, Mozaic, areal density STX has stronger technology-cycle leverage
Key investment variable Cloud purity, customer concentration, margin HAMR ramp, qualification, ASP Different analytical frameworks

If you track WDC, focus on:

  • whether Cloud revenue mix stays high;
  • whether nearline exabytes continue to grow;
  • whether non-GAAP gross margin remains strong;
  • whether large customer demand remains visible;
  • whether the post-Sandisk HDD business continues to convert revenue into free cash flow.

If you track STX, focus on:

  • whether mass capacity revenue continues to grow;
  • whether high-capacity nearline demand stays strong;
  • whether HAMR and Mozaic qualification progresses;
  • whether larger drives reduce cost per terabyte;
  • whether cloud customer demand reflects long-term expansion rather than short-term inventory building.

Bottom line: WDC is the cleaner cloud storage exposure, while STX has stronger technology-cycle leverage. WDC’s Cloud revenue share and nearline exabytes make the cloud demand signal easier to verify. STX’s upside depends more on mass capacity demand, HAMR execution, and whether customers adopt higher-capacity drives at scale. You should not describe WDC as simply “better” or STX as simply “less cloud-dependent.” WDC has higher cloud revenue purity. STX has high cloud sensitivity through product innovation and high-capacity drive cycles.

Cash Flow: Both Companies Are Converting Cloud Demand Into Free Cash Flow

Cash flow tells a more balanced story than revenue mix. In Q3 FY2026, both WDC and STX converted strong cloud and AI storage demand into powerful operating cash flow. WDC generated $978 million in free cash flow, while STX generated $953 million. WDC had higher revenue and a higher non-GAAP gross margin, but Seagate also showed strong cash generation, debt reduction, dividends, and share repurchases. The gap is smaller than the cloud-revenue comparison suggests.

WDC’s cash flow improvement is significant. In Western Digital’s Q3 FY2026 results, revenue was $3.337 billion, up 45% year over year. Non-GAAP gross margin reached 50.5%, operating cash flow was $1.123 billion, and free cash flow was $978 million. For an HDD company, a 50% non-GAAP gross margin is a strong signal. It suggests that high-capacity product mix, cloud demand, supply discipline, and cost control are all improving earnings quality.

STX also delivered strong cash flow. In Seagate’s Q3 FY2026 results, revenue was $3.112 billion, non-GAAP gross margin was 47.0%, operating cash flow was $1.1 billion, and free cash flow was $953 million. During the same quarter, Seagate retired about $641 million of debt and returned $191 million to shareholders through dividends and share repurchases. That shows the company is not only benefiting from demand, but also repairing its balance sheet and returning capital.

Metric WDC Q3 FY2026 STX Q3 FY2026 Meaning
Revenue $3.337 billion $3.112 billion WDC was slightly higher
Non-GAAP gross margin 50.5% 47.0% WDC was stronger
Operating cash flow $1.123 billion About $1.1 billion Very close
Free cash flow $978 million $953 million Very close
Capital allocation Buybacks, stronger net cash position Debt reduction, dividends, buybacks Both are in a strong cash-flow phase

Still, one quarter does not define the cycle. HDD remains cyclical. Strong free cash flow can come from real demand growth, but it can also reflect supply discipline, pricing improvement, customer inventory rebuilding, and product mix. You should keep watching FCF margin, capex intensity, inventory, accounts receivable, purchase commitments, cloud capex guidance, and signs of order pushouts.

Bottom line: Cash flow does not support a simple “WDC is much stronger than STX” conclusion. WDC has stronger cloud revenue visibility, higher revenue, and a higher non-GAAP gross margin. STX has nearly the same free cash flow and is also reducing debt while returning capital to shareholders. The real question is whether this level of free cash flow can last across multiple quarters. If hyperscaler storage demand remains strong, both companies benefit. If AI capex cools or customers enter an inventory digestion phase, both companies can face pressure.

AI Data Center Demand: Why Cloud Procurement Changes the HDD Cycle

AI data centers have changed how investors view HDD companies. WDC and STX used to be seen mainly as hardware-cycle names tied to PCs, consumer storage, and enterprise replacement demand. Now high-capacity HDD is increasingly linked to cloud infrastructure, AI data retention, object storage, backup, and cold data. Neither WDC nor STX is a pure AI compute stock, but both sit in the capacity layer of the AI data lifecycle.

Many investors focus first on GPUs, HBM, advanced packaging, and power infrastructure. That makes sense, but storage is part of the same system. AI training requires datasets. Inference creates logs and user interaction data. Enterprise AI adoption increases demand for documents, images, video, voice data, audit trails, and compliance archives. Not all of this data needs expensive high-performance SSD storage. A large amount needs stable, scalable, low-cost capacity. That is where HDD remains important.

WDC has emphasized that AI workloads create large amounts of data that need persistent, cost-efficient storage. Seagate has made a similar argument in its filings and prepared remarks, connecting generative AI, digital content growth, cloud infrastructure, and hyperscale data center expansion to capacity demand. In Seagate Q4 FY2025 prepared remarks, management discussed strong mass capacity demand and the importance of high-capacity products. Market attention has also shifted: Reuters’ report on AI-driven demand for storage firms connected investor enthusiasm in data storage stocks to the expansion of AI infrastructure.

HDD still has a role because of cost and capacity. SSD is better for hot data, low-latency workloads, databases, caching, and performance-sensitive training infrastructure. HDD is better for large-scale capacity layers such as cold data, object storage, backup, archive, data lakes, and long-term retention. Cloud customers do not simply buy the fastest storage. They optimize across performance, cost per terabyte, energy use, rack space, reliability, and lifecycle management.

AI Data Type Common Storage Layer Meaning for WDC and STX
Training hot data SSD / high-performance storage More indirect benefit
Inference logs HDD plus object storage Expands long-term capacity demand
Images, video, voice data Tiered storage including HDD Supports nearline HDD demand
Backup and archive HDD / tape / cloud archive Reinforces low-cost capacity needs
Compliance retention HDD / object storage Supports persistent storage demand

But AI-driven HDD demand is not a straight line. Cloud companies may pull forward orders, delay capacity builds, adjust capex, or pause procurement if power, land, financing costs, or AI return on investment become concerns. If several large cloud buyers slow purchasing at the same time, WDC and STX can both see pressure on revenue, margins, and order visibility.

For WDC, the most direct AI storage indicators are Cloud revenue mix, nearline exabytes, and gross margin. For STX, the better indicators are mass capacity revenue, HAMR qualification, high-capacity drive adoption, and cloud customer demand. Both benefit from AI data growth, but you need different metrics to verify the strength of that benefit.

Bottom line: AI data centers have brought HDD companies back into the market conversation, but their role is not compute. Their role is the capacity layer of the AI data lifecycle. WDC has clearer Cloud revenue and nearline exabyte disclosure. STX has a stronger mass capacity and HAMR technology story. AI can increase storage demand, but it does not remove cyclical risk. The key question is whether data growth can keep converting into revenue, margin expansion, and free cash flow.

Investment Framework: Which Company Is More Dependent on Cloud Customers?

The final answer has three layers. By revenue mix, WDC is more dependent on cloud customers. By product demand, STX is also highly tied to cloud customers. By risk source, WDC requires closer attention to customer concentration, while STX requires closer attention to mass capacity demand, HAMR execution, and high-capacity drive adoption. Higher cloud dependence is not automatically good or bad. It means higher exposure to cloud storage growth and higher sensitivity to cloud procurement cycles.

If you prefer clean financial verification, WDC is easier to analyze. Cloud revenue share, nearline exabytes, gross margin, free cash flow, and customer concentration all provide direct signals. WDC’s advantage is that cloud storage purity is high and visible. Its risk is the same thing: if cloud customers change procurement timing, the impact can show up quickly in financial results.

If you prefer technology-cycle leverage, STX deserves a separate framework. Seagate’s cloud dependence is not low; it is simply disclosed differently. The company emphasizes high-capacity drives, mass capacity storage, HAMR, Mozaic, and areal density. The key question is whether Seagate can use higher drive capacity to improve customer total cost of ownership and convert the technology roadmap into revenue, margin, and cash flow.

Decision Angle More Relevant to WDC More Relevant to STX Practical Reading
Cloud revenue share Yes Not disclosed in the same way WDC is clearer
Customer concentration risk More visible Less visible by single-customer disclosure WDC needs closer customer tracking
Technology-cycle leverage ePMR, nearline HAMR, Mozaic STX has stronger technology narrative
Free cash flow Strong Strong Q3 FY2026 gap was small
AI data center sensitivity High High Neither is a defensive stock

A practical tracking framework can look like this:

  • For WDC: monitor Cloud revenue share, nearline exabytes, customer concentration, gross margin, and free cash flow.
  • For STX: monitor mass capacity revenue, HAMR qualification, high-capacity drive ramp, ASP trends, and gross margin.
  • For the industry: monitor hyperscaler capex, AI infrastructure spending, HDD supply discipline, power constraints, and storage pricing.
  • For financial quality: monitor free cash flow, inventory, receivables, debt reduction, dividends, and buybacks.
  • For valuation: ask whether the stock price already discounts several quarters of strong demand.

For ordinary investors, WDC and STX should not be compared through one metric alone. WDC appears more dependent on cloud customers, but that can create strong upside during a cloud storage upcycle. STX’s cloud exposure is less directly reported, but its mass capacity and HAMR cycles are still driven by cloud storage demand. Both companies are high-sensitivity AI infrastructure storage names rather than defensive hardware stocks.

Bottom line: WDC is more visibly dependent on cloud customers, but STX is not a low-cloud-exposure company. WDC’s dependence appears in Cloud revenue, nearline exabytes, and customer concentration. STX’s dependence appears in mass capacity storage, nearline HDD, HAMR, and hyperscaler procurement. If you care about revenue transparency and cloud storage purity, WDC is easier to study. If you care about high-capacity HDD technology transitions, STX deserves close attention.

FAQ

Which Company Has Higher Cloud Revenue Exposure, WDC or STX?

WDC has the higher and clearer reported cloud revenue exposure. In Q3 FY2026, Cloud represented about 89% of WDC revenue. STX does not report revenue using the same Cloud / Client / Consumer format, so its cloud exposure must be assessed through mass capacity revenue, nearline HDD demand, and hyperscaler commentary.

Is Seagate Mass Capacity Revenue the Same as Cloud Revenue?

No, Seagate mass capacity revenue is not the same as pure cloud revenue. It can include cloud, hyperscale, enterprise data center, edge, and other large-capacity storage use cases. For STX, mass capacity is a useful cloud-demand signal, but it should be combined with nearline HDD trends, HAMR progress, and customer qualification updates.

Should Western Digital Still Be Analyzed as a Flash Storage Company After the Sandisk Separation?

Western Digital should now be analyzed mainly as an HDD and data storage infrastructure company. After the Sandisk separation, WDC’s continuing business is much more focused on hard drives and data center storage. When comparing WDC with STX, it is better not to mix Sandisk’s flash business into WDC’s current operating profile.

Why Do AI Data Centers Still Need HDDs?

AI data centers still need HDDs because not all data requires high-performance SSD storage. Training datasets, inference logs, backups, archives, object storage, compliance data, and cold data often require low-cost, high-capacity, persistent storage. HDD demand still depends on cloud capex, data center expansion, and storage procurement cycles.

How Should Investors Compare WDC and STX Customer Concentration Risk?

WDC’s customer concentration risk is more visible because its top ten customers generated 68% of FY2025 revenue, with three customers at 17%, 12%, and 10%. STX had one customer around 10%, but it still depends heavily on overall hyperscaler storage demand. WDC has clearer large-customer risk; STX has broader product-cycle and cloud-demand risk.

What Metrics Should Investors Track for WDC and STX?

For WDC, track Cloud revenue, nearline exabytes, gross margin, free cash flow, and customer concentration. For STX, track mass capacity revenue, HAMR and Mozaic progress, high-capacity drive demand, gross margin, and free cash flow.
